Alright, let’s get down to the nitty-gritty of the types of elections you’ll find in Bexar County. First up, we have Primary Elections. Think of these as the preliminary rounds. They're where registered voters of a specific party choose their nominees for the upcoming general election. In Texas, you can vote in either the Democratic or Republican primary, but you can only vote in one. These primaries are super important because they often determine who'll actually win in the general election, especially in areas where one party dominates. Next, we have General Elections, which are the main event! This is when the nominees from all parties face off, along with any independent candidates. This is when the final decisions are made for most of the races, from the President of the United States down to local positions. Turnout is generally higher in general elections, and every vote counts! Then we've got Special Elections. These are less common but just as important. They're called to fill vacancies when an elected official leaves office before their term is up, or to decide on specific issues like bond propositions. These elections might seem less frequent, but they can have a big impact on your community, so it's essential to stay informed about them. And finally, don’t forget about Runoff Elections. If no candidate in a primary or general election gets a majority of the votes (more than 50%), then a runoff election is held between the top two candidates. These runoffs can be crucial, as they determine the ultimate winner. Keep an eye out for these, especially in close races!
